noob type question here

ok I have some 19" staggered on my 02' C240. I love how they sit in the rear but the front sucks. The front sits too high. I was wondering if there is an easy way to fix this problem. I don't know too much about these particular cars, but I know cars in general and can do most work myself. I heard that there are rubber isolators that you can change out and not effect the actual spring, but not sure if that is true or not. any help would be greatly appreciated. thank you!

I believe it's called the spring pad. Search under W203 forum, there are discussion about this. Some folks replace the spring with the newer w203 springs. I have 06 C230SS I notice mine is lower than the older C240.
